Egypt - Buffalo Meat Slaughtering
Since 2014, Egypt Buffalo Meat Slaughtering fell by 1.1% year on year. With 1,088,548 Heads in 2019, the country was ranked number 4 comparing other countries in Buffalo Meat Slaughtering. Egypt is overtaken by China, which was ranked number 3 at 4,462,327 Heads and is followed by Nepal with 811,187 Heads. India ranked the highest with 11,682,255 Heads in 2019, that is a fall of 2.1% versus 2018. Greece recorded the best 5 years average growth at +42% per year, while Turkey was the worst growing country at -31.1% per year.
